A man from Texas has broken the Lake Corpus Christi record for largest alligator gar. His catch reportedly weighed 207 pounds and measured 90 inches in length.
The wildlife agency revealed Hefner’s catch to the public with photo-inclusive Twitter and Facebook posts that show the massive fish was longer than its catcher’s body. Cortney Moore is an associate lifestyle writer on the Lifestyle team at Fox News Digital.
"Move over, Rover. This 207 lb alligator gar set a new record for Lake Corpus Christi before being released back to swim another day," the Texas Parks and Wildlife wrote in both posts.
